A Voyage Through Sandstone Colors

Sedimentary sandstone forms through a fascinating geological cycle. Over vast stretches of age, tiny particles of rock are carried by ice and eventually deposited in layers. As these strata accumulate, they harden under the weight of later layers, forming sandstone rocks. The unique colors of sandstone originate from the presence of diverse minerals within the sediment. Iron oxides, for instance, give rise to hues of red.

Geological Processes Shaping Sandstone Formations

Sandstone formations result from a captivating interplay of geological processes spanning millions of years. Deposition is the initial step, where grains of sand are transported by means such as wind, water, or ice and accumulated in a setting. Over time, these layers of material become solidified under the pressure of overlying layers.
